Family tree Hoven » Petronella Matthea Burgerhof (1899-1905)

Personal data Petronella Matthea Burgerhof 

  • She was born on May 1, 1899 in 's-Hertogenbosch.

  • She died on January 25, 1905 in 's-Hertogenbosch, she was 5 years old.

  • A child of Martinus Fredericus Burgerhof and Anna Elisabeth Hoven
